Transaction 5270c5cc66f5496345dacb00699efc67bafca803852ebbf88adf98130571b920
1 Input
1 Output
-
5270c5cc66f5496345dacb00699efc67bafca803852ebbf88adf98130571b920:0
- value
- 4058510
- script pubkey
- OP_0 OP_PUSHBYTES_20 7774f970f03ae82d3ebf2bdf125bf2851a670ce9
- address
- bc1qwa60ju8s8t5z604l9003ykljs5dxwr8fqf03n2